Fiftieth Legislature - First Regular Session (2011)

AI Summary

  • Amends Arizona Revised Statutes section 28-3306 to allow the Department of Motor Vehicles to require attendance and successful completion of approved traffic survival school as an alternative to license suspension or revocation.

  • Requires the department to notify licensees in writing immediately when ordering them to attend traffic survival school, and allows licensees to request a hearing within 30 days of receiving notice.

  • Adds a new provision requiring the department to withhold license reinstatement if a licensee fails to comply with an order to attend traffic survival school, until proof of successful completion is provided.

  • Maintains existing hearing procedures and department authority to suspend or revoke licenses based on eight specified grounds, including traffic violations, accidents, reckless driving, and fraud.

  • Authorizes the department to amend suspension orders to revocation if a licensee receives notice to attend traffic school but fails to comply with that order.
